
Mata Mua by Paul Gauguin
Mata Mua — meaning "once upon a time" — is one of Gauguin's most luminous visions of Tahitian life. Figures move through a landscape saturated with deep greens, warm ochres, and the kind of unapologetic color that European painting rarely dared. The composition is layered but unhurried: a tree divides the scene, dancers occupy the middle ground, and a sense of ritual calm settles over everything. It belongs firmly to the Post-Impressionist moment when painting broke free of naturalistic obligation.
